Key ceremony checklist, item 4 (weekly eng sync): Barcode scanner integration for Stockhaven WMS. Confirm the Cravenmark scanner firmware is pinned to the signed build, verify the pairing cert was rotated after last month's ceremony, and log witness initials. Before sealing the hardware case, the presiding engineer must read aloud and record the recovery passphrase shown below.

strongbox words: sorir-belvan-rusix-ulays-ralmir-praix-eliir-tamax-praael-druael-julir-tamius-jorir

Fabrikata is the library our services use to generate deterministic test fixtures. On-call engineers mostly touch it when a seeded environment drifts and integration tests start failing. Rebuilding fixtures is safe: run the `fabrikata reseed` task against the sandbox database only, never production. The task reads its configuration from the service env file in the deploy directory. Seeding pulls reference records from the Corvane fixtures API, which requires authentication, and that credential is defined on the following line.

sealed setting: ARCHIVE_KEY3=8d0

Handover note — Crumbwheel order cutoffs.

Welcome aboard. The bakery cutoff rule in Crumbwheel closes same-day orders at 14:00 local to each storefront, not UTC — this has bitten us twice. Holiday overrides live in the calendar service and take precedence silently, so always check there first when a cutoff looks wrong. To unlock the calendar service's admin console after a restart, enter the recovery passphrase below.

vault phrase of bagap-bahaf = silion-pelox-sorox-casdor-quenwyn-fraax-eliox-praael-kelion-quenvan-kasox-rusael-norius-belvan

## Runbook: Wirelark WS compression

Per-message deflate cuts bandwidth ~60% on Wirelark's telemetry streams but costs CPU and memory per connection (context takeover). Under 40k concurrent sockets, keep it on. Above that, disable takeover first; only then drop compression entirely. Mobile clients on the Petrel app tolerate the latency bump; the Kestrel dashboard does not. Current production settings for the compression layer are listed below.

settings of tagef-bawif:
DRUIX_HOST=druix.zemvarlabs.internal
DRUIX_PORT=8000